### Fix: tolerate clock skew between Beltline build agents

Our artifact cache keyed comparisons on wall-clock timestamps, and agents in the Northquay pool drift a few seconds between NTP syncs. That caused spurious cache invalidations and, rarely, stale artifacts being accepted. This PR switches comparisons to a monotonic epoch counter where possible and, where wall clocks are unavoidable, applies an explicit skew tolerance window with rejection beyond a hard cap. The tolerance constants introduced by this change are listed below.

constants for bawif-kawif:
QUOTAS = {
    "ulaael": 5,
    "holael": 10,
}

Facilities ticket — Night shift, Brindlecote Campus. Twenty-two interns from the Fennhollow programme arrive tomorrow at 08:00. Please unlock seminar rooms B2 and B3 by 06:30, set chairs to classroom layout, and confirm the water coolers on level one are refilled. Leave the loading bay clear for their equipment van. Overnight access to the prep corridor requires the pass code below.

badge for bajop-yawep: bdg-NNHEW-6

Handover — Vexler partner SFTP drop

Ownership moves to you today. Drop runs hourly from Vexler's end into the intake bucket via the relay host. Watch for zero-byte files; their exporter flakes on Mondays. Creds live in the ops vault, path noted in the runbook. Vault auto-seals after 48h idle. Support escalations go to the on-call rotation, not me. If the vault is sealed when you need it, unseal with the recovery passphrase below.

recovery phrase for tadug-fafof: zorwyn-kasion

We're seeing 800ms–1.2s stop-the-world pauses roughly every 40 minutes under peak load, which blows our match-latency SLO. Heap dumps point to the candidate-pool cache retaining expired entries; the generational promotion rate spikes right before each pause. I tried bumping young-gen size, which helped marginally but didn't fix root cause. Next step is switching the cache to off-heap storage and re-running the load test. My notes, dumps, and flame graphs are collected on the internal page below.

wiki page, tahaf-tajog: https://jira.ordindyn.corp/pipeline